#04c541 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#04c541 is composed of 1.6% red, 77.3% green and 25.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98% cyan, 0% magenta, 67%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 139 degrees, a saturation of 96% and a lightness of 39.4%. #04c541 color hex could be obtained by blending #08ff82 with #008b00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

Shades and Tints of #04c541
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000502 is the darkest color, while #f1fff5 is the lightest one.
